The meaning of walking alone

Zhenzhen alone means: walking alone.

1. Basic meaning

Zuzhuoxing, a Chinese idiom, pinyin: jǔ jǔ dú xíng, which means walking alone. Describes being very lonely. Zhenzhen: A lonely look. Origin of the idiom: Walking alone, there is no one else, not as good as my common father. From "The Book of Songs·Tang Feng·Ji Du": "Walking alone in zui, there is no one else, not as good as my common father." Xu Chi's "Goldbach's Conjecture": He became a person walking alone, alone, talking to himself, lonely of deformed people. In the sky, a lone wild goose.
